WebAbstract: The nullity of a graph is the multiplicity of the eigenvalue zero in its spectrum. Among n -vertex trees, the star has greatest nullity (equal to n − 2). We generalize this by showing that among n -vertex trees whose vertex degrees do not exceed a certain value D , the greatest nullity is n − 2⌈( n − 1)/ D ⌉. ... Web17 iul. 2016 · The multiplicity of that zero is the number of times the factor appears in the polynomial when it is factored completely. Another example. Let p (x) = (x − 6) 5 (x + 4) 4. The zeros are 6 and −4. the zero 6 has multiplicity 5 and the zero −4 has multiplicity 4.
